“Matilda,” “Lucky Guy” and “The Nance” Take Top Tony Honors for Lighting, Scenic Design

NEW YORK — Matilda the Musical garnered top Tony honors in the Musical category for both Lighting and Scenic Design. Tony winners for Lighting and Scenic Design in the Play category were Lucky Guy and The Nance. The award for Best Musical and Best Play went, respectively, to Kinky Boots and Vanya and Sonia and Masha and Spike. The awards were presented at Radio City Music Hall June 9.

GoVision’s Brady Haass Promoted to VP Client Services

ARGYLE, TX  – Brady Haass, the third-most-senior employee at GoVision LP, was promoted to the new position of vice president, client services.  GoVision is a supplier of customized modular LED walls and turnkey mobile LED units. Haass, who has been largely responsible for the company’s rapid growth in clients as well as its successful expansion into new markets, celebrated his 10th anniversary with GoVision on March 27.

ADJ Group To Open South Florida Complex

OPA LOCKA, FL – Los Angeles-based ADJ Group, a global supplier of lighting, audio and trussing products, announced that it will open a new multi-functional facility in south Florida later this year.  Strategically located near airport and shipping facilities, the new ADJ complex will serve the company’s customers east of the Mississippi, as well as those in Central America, the Caribbean and South America.  ADJ customers in south Florida will be able to pick up orders from the facility on the same day they’re placed.

Group One Hires Brad White to Manage Avolites

FARMINGDALE, NY — Avolites, the London-based lighting console manufacturer, named Group One Ltd. as its exclusive distributor in U.S.  In a related move, Group One, based here, named Brad White national sales manager for the brand. White, who had previously spent 12 years as director of technical services at Avolites America, most recently served as COO at TERI Productions, Knoxville, TN. White has also worked at PixelRange and as an LD and programmer. Prior to the early June announcement, Avolites’ U.S. distributor was Creative Stage Lighting (CSL), North Creek, NY.

Charges Filed in Radiohead Staging Collapse

TORONTO — The Ontario Ministry of Labor, which has been investigating what led to the structural collapse that killed drum tech Scott Johnson, 33, on June 16, 2012, filed eight charges against Live Nation Canada Inc. and Live Nation Ontario Concerts GP Inc., four charges against Optex Staging & Services Inc., and a single charge against Domenic Cugliari, an engineer based in Bolton, ON, according to reports.

Daft Punk’s Global Launch Uses Martin LC Panel Dance Floor

WEE WAA, Australia – The small Australian town of Wee Waa made the headlines last month by hosting the official global launch party for Daft Punk’s Random Access Memories. Daft Punk’s production house Daft Arts conceived and designed the space, described as a cross between Saturday Night Fever and Close Encounters Of The Third Kind. The dance floor, which resembled an LP record, comprised of 110 Martin LC Panels and 16 Martin LC Plus Panels.

ETC’s Fred Foster Receives ‘Seize the Day’ Award

MIDDLETON, WI – ETC CEO Fred Foster received the 10th annual Ken Hendricks Memorial ‘Seize the Day’ Award at the Wisconsin Entrepreneurs’ Conference in Middleton, WI. The award celebrates entrepreneurial leaders who have been crucial to Wisconsin’s economic growth.  The award is not given for technical innovation but for innovative leadership – the ability to transform business opportunities into successes.
